Output faa8b21ec5878954251e311ebb303e916e4bc0dc9242f5a8d552d1c29c2a6e03:5

value
269000
script pubkey
OP_0 OP_PUSHBYTES_20 38c59ac67e4a9fd810cd07df715889fe37cdd5d1
address
bc1q8rze43n7f20asyxdql0hzkyflcmum4w3p9a09c
transaction
faa8b21ec5878954251e311ebb303e916e4bc0dc9242f5a8d552d1c29c2a6e03